Messerschmitt bf 109 D/E



Model: Messerschmitt 109 D
Power Plant: 1-700 hp Junker Jumo 210 G
Dimensions: Wing Span 32.5'; Length 28.5'
Maximum Speed: 470 km/h at 3750 m
Armament: 4x7.9mm ffMG
Payload: none
Total Production: 30,500+ All Models
In Service: Luftwaffe (1938)

The Messerschmitt 109 was the most important german fighter of WWII totalling over 30,000 built. The D model was a slight improvement over the previous B & C ones. # 79 was operated by staffel 3, J/88 during the spanish civil war in 1938, mounted by Werner Molders, top german ace during the SCW with 14 kills.
